Home and Destination Charging (0 -> 100%)

Charging is possible by using a regular wall plug or a charging station. Public charging is always done through a charging station. How fast the EV can charge depends on the charging station (EVSE) used and the maximum charging capacity of the EV. The table below shows all possible options for charging the Hyundai Kona Electric 48 kWh. Each option shows how fast the battery can be charged from empty to full.

Europe

Charging an EV in Europe differs by country. Some European countries primarily use 1-phase connections to the grid, while other countries are almost exclusively using a 3-phase connection. The table below shows all possible ways the Hyundai Kona Electric 48 kWh can be charged, but some modes of charging might not be widely available in certain countries.

Type 2 (Mennekes - IEC 62196)
Charging PointMax. PowerPowerTimeRate
Wall Plug (2.3 kW)230V / 1x10A2.3 kW24h45m12 km/h
1-phase 16A (3.7 kW)230V / 1x16A3.7 kW15h30m19 km/h
1-phase 32A (7.4 kW)230V / 1x32A7.4 kW7h45m38 km/h
3-phase 16A (11 kW)400V / 3x16A11 kW5h15m56 km/h
3-phase 32A (22 kW)400V / 3x16A11 kW †5h15m56 km/h

† = Limited by on-board charger, vehicle cannot charge faster.

Fast Charging (10 -> 80%)

Rapid charging enables longer journeys by adding as much range as possible in the shortest amount of time. Charging power will decrease significantly after 80% state-of-charge has been reached. A typical rapid charge therefore rarely exceeds 80% SoC. The rapid charge rate of an EV depends on the charger used and the maximum charging power the EV can handle. The table below shows all details for rapid charging the Hyundai Kona Electric 48 kWh.

Hyundai has not released details about rapid charging the Kona. The information below is based on estimated values of the most likely rapid charging capabilities.

  • Max. Power: maximum power provided by charge point
  • Avg. Power: average power provided by charge point over a session from 10% to 80%
  • Time: time needed to charge from 10% to 80%
  • Rate: average charging speed over a session from 10% to 80%
Combined Charging System (CCS Combo 2)
Charging PointMax. PowerAvg. PowerTimeRate
CCS (50 kW DC)50 kW35 kW †61 min200 km/h
CCS (100 kW DC)75 kW †50 kW †43 min280 km/h
CCS (150 kW DC)75 kW †50 kW †43 min280 km/h
This vehicle supports Autocharge
This vehicle supports Plug & Charge

† = Limited by charging capabilities of vehicle

Autocharge: allows for automatic initiation of a charging session at supported CCS charging stations.

Plug & Charge: allows for automatic initiation of a charging session at supported CCS charging stations in accordance with ISO 15118.

Actual charging rates may differ from data shown due to factors like outside temperature, state of the battery and driving style.

About this Vehicle

Hyundai Kona Electric 48 kWh Overview

The Hyundai Kona Electric 48 kWh positions itself as a budget-friendly mainstream electric SUV, ideal for urban commuters and small families seeking an affordable entry into EV ownership. With a starting price around £34,995 in key markets, this Hyundai electric SUV targets value-conscious buyers who prioritize efficiency and practicality over luxury. Its compact dimensions—4,355 mm long and 2,100 mm wide with mirrors—make it perfect for city parking and maneuvering, while seating five passengers comfortably.

Key distinguishing features include a 400V architecture with a Permanent Magnet Synchronous Motor (PMSM), delivering smooth front-wheel drive (FWD) performance. The Hyundai Kona Electric 48 kWh review highlights its advanced aerodynamics (drag coefficient of 0.275), standard heat pump for efficiency, and active airflow management. In the competitive EV landscape, it matters as a high-efficiency subcompact option with real-world usability, offering up to 200 miles EPA range and versatile cargo space (466L trunk, expanding to 1,300L). This electric vehicle range champ stands out for blending affordability with modern tech like Vehicle-to-Load (V2L) capability.

Hyundai Kona Electric 48 kWh Performance and Driving Experience

The Hyundai Kona Electric 48 kWh delivers competent acceleration with its 133 hp (99 kW) single front motor producing 255 Nm (188 lb-ft) of instant torque, hitting 0-60 mph in about 8.6-8.8 seconds. Top speed caps at 160 km/h (99 mph), prioritizing efficiency over outright speed. Handling is tuned for comfort, with a quiet cabin and isolated electric powertrain making it an easygoing daily driver—ideal for highways and city streets, though not sporty.

Real-world impressions emphasize its smooth FWD dynamics, competent cornering, and relaxed ride, thanks to the subcompact SUV platform. No AWD option here, keeping it lightweight at 1,690 kg curb weight.

Hyundai Kona Electric 48 kWh Range and Battery Specifications

Official Hyundai Kona Electric 48 kWh WLTP range reaches 377 km (234 miles), while EPA range is 200 miles, with real-world estimates around 200-235 miles (322 km GCC, 295 km tested). The 48.4 kWh usable (51 kWh nominal) lithium-ion battery excels in efficiency at 15.5 kWh/100 km (110 MPGe combined), aided by a heat pump and low-drag design. Factors like cold weather, aggressive driving, or hilly terrain can drop real-world range by 20-30%.

This setup suits most daily needs, with energy use varying: 131 MPGe city, 105 MPGe highway.

Hyundai Kona Electric 48 kWh Charging Times and Options

Home charging is straightforward: Level 1 (120V) takes about 30+ hours for a full charge, while Level 2 at 11 kW (240V) completes in 4-5 hours (10-100%). DC fast charging peaks at 75 kW, achieving 10-80% in 43-45 minutes via CCS Type 2 port—compatible with major networks. Practical scenarios include overnight Level 2 for commuters or quick DC top-ups on road trips, with V2L for powering devices.
